Digital Data and Jurisdictional Challenges
Digital data presents unique jurisdictional challenges due to its borderless nature. Determining the applicable jurisdiction becomes complex when data resides across multiple countries or cloud servers. This raises questions about which legal system governs the data and disputes arising from it.
Courts often rely on conflict of laws principles, such as the most significant connection test, to address these issues. However, the diverse regulations across jurisdictions, like the European Union’s GDPR, complicate enforcement and compliance. This inconsistency can hinder effective regulation and dispute resolution in cross-border scenarios.
Enforcement of data-related judgments is further hindered by sovereignty concerns and varying national laws. Data localization requirements aim to address these challenges but may conflict with globalization efforts and technological innovation. Navigating these jurisdictional issues remains a significant aspect of applying conflict principles to new tech.

Intellectual Property Disputes in the Digital Age
Intellectual property disputes in the digital age present complex challenges due to the borderless nature of technology. Digital platforms enable rapid dissemination of content, increasing the likelihood of infringement across jurisdictions. This underscores the importance of applying conflict principles to address jurisdictional issues effectively.
The application of conflict principles becomes vital when determining which legal system has authority over digital intellectual property disputes. Courts often employ criteria such as the location of the unauthorized act or the defendant’s place of business to establish jurisdiction. These principles aim to balance rights and responsibilities in an increasingly interconnected digital environment.
Additionally, the enforcement of intellectual property rights across borders involves hurdles related to differing legal standards and procedures. International cooperation and treaties like the TRIPS Agreement strive to harmonize laws, but challenges persist, especially in fast-evolving digital contexts. This highlights the necessity of adapting conflict resolution strategies to better suit these technological realities.
Applying the Most Significant Connection Test to Emerging Technologies
The most significant connection test is a fundamental principle in the conflict of laws, determining which jurisdiction’s law applies to a dispute. When applied to emerging technologies, this test helps identify the jurisdiction with the strongest link to a digital or cross-border scenario.
In the context of new tech, courts analyze factors such as where the data is stored, where the party responsible is based, and where the harm occurred. This assessment ensures that jurisdictional claims are rooted in meaningful geographical connections.
Applying the test to emerging technologies like blockchain or cloud computing presents unique challenges. These technologies often operate across multi-jurisdictional networks, complicating the identification of the most significant connection. Accurate application requires careful evaluation of technological architecture and data flows.
While the test aims to promote legal certainty, its effective use in the fast-evolving tech landscape depends on adaptable legal interpretations. As new technologies emerge, courts must refine the application of the most significant connection test to address complex, borderless digital interactions.
The Role of Public Policy in Tech-Related Conflict of Laws
Public policy significantly influences the application of conflict principles to new tech, as it often serves as a guiding standard when laws from different jurisdictions conflict. Courts frequently consider whether enforcing certain laws aligns with national interests, societal values, and public welfare.
In the realm of tech-related conflicts, public policy acts as a safeguard against legal decisions that could undermine essential societal goals, such as privacy rights, cybersecurity, or economic stability. For instance, a jurisdiction may refuse to recognize a foreign judgment if it contravenes fundamental public policy principles like data sovereignty or human rights.
Furthermore, public policy considerations can limit the extraterritorial application of laws or impose restrictions on cross-border data flow. These principles help balance the interests of technological innovation with societal protections, shaping how conflict of laws principles are applied and harmonized across borders.
Challenges of Enforcing Foreign Judgments for Tech Disputes
Enforcing foreign judgments for tech disputes often encounters legal and procedural obstacles due to jurisdictional differences. Variations in national laws can hinder the recognition and enforcement process, complicating cross-border resolution efforts.
Differences in legal standards pose significant challenges. Some countries require reciprocity or specific conditions before recognizing foreign judgments, which may not always be met in tech-related disputes, particularly involving rapidly evolving digital issues.
Additional complexities include jurisdictional disputes over which court has authority. Conflicting laws regarding the applicable jurisdiction can delay enforcement or render judgments unenforceable. Clear conflict-of-laws rules are vital to navigate these issues effectively.
Key challenges include:
- Divergent national enforcement laws affecting tech judgments.
- Jurisdictional conflicts over authority.
- Variability in legal standards for recognition.
- Difficulties in enforcing judgments against entities with limited assets or obfuscated identities in the tech sector.

The Impact of Cryptography and Blockchain on Conflict Resolution
Cryptography and blockchain technology significantly influence conflict resolution in the application of conflict principles to new tech. They introduce new mechanisms for secure communication, data integrity, and decentralization, thereby affecting jurisdictional determinations and dispute enforcement.
Cryptography ensures confidentiality and authenticity of digital data, which is vital in cross-border conflicts involving sensitive information. By enabling encrypted communications, it complicates jurisdictional assertions based solely on data location. Blockchain’s decentralized ledger provides transparency and tamper resistance, reducing disputes over data manipulation or evidence authenticity.
However, these technologies also pose challenges to traditional conflict resolution frameworks. Jurisdictional questions arise around which authority governs data stored across multiple systems or sovereign borders. Additionally, enforcing foreign judgments becomes complex due to the anonymous or pseudonymous nature of blockchain participants.
Overall, cryptography and blockchain compel legal systems to adapt conflict principles to account for technological neutrality, decentralization, and data sovereignty issues. They emphasize the need for evolving legal standards that effectively address the unique features of emerging digital conflicts.
